Jump to navigationJump to searchHenrik Ibsen - (March 20, 1828 – May 23, 1906) was an extremely influential Norwegian playwright who was largely responsible for the rise of the modern realistic drama (dubbed "the father of modern drama"). It is said that Ibsen is the most frequently performed dramatist in the world after Shakespeare.
His numerous works include: (1892) The Master Builder (Bygmester Solness) which is referenced in Joyce's Finnegans Wake.
